In the 185-page ruling (available here) the judge wrote:
“ Ultimately, after evaluating the trial evidence, the Court finds that the
relevant market here is digital mobile gaming transactions, not gaming
generally and not Apple’s own internal operating systems related to the App
Store. The mobile gaming market itself is a $100 billion industry. The size
of this market explains Epic Games’ motive in bringing this action. Having
penetrated all other video game markets, the mobile gaming market was Epic
Games’ next target and it views Apple as an impediment.
“Further, the evidence demonstrates that most App Store revenue is generated
by mobile gaming apps, not all apps. Thus, defining the market to focus on
gaming apps is appropriate. Generally speaking, on a revenue basis, gaming
apps account for approximately 70% of all App Store revenues. This 70% of
revenue is generated by less than 10% of all App Store consumers. These
gaming-app consumers are primarily making in-app purchases which is the focus
of Epic Games’ claims. By contrast, over 80% of all consumer accounts
generate virtually no revenue, as 80% of all apps on the App Store are free.
The judgement also says
“Having defined the relevant market as digital mobile gaming transactions,
the Court next evaluated Apple’s conduct in that market. Given the trial
record, the Court cannot ultimately conclude that Apple is a monopolist under
either federal or state antitrust laws. While the Court finds that Apple
enjoys considerable market share of over 55% and extraordinarily high profit
margins, these factors alone do not show antitrust conduct. Success is not
illegal. The final trial record did not include evidence of other critical
factors, such as barriers to entry and conduct decreasing output or
decreasing innovation in the relevant market. The Court does not find that it
is impossible; only that Epic Games failed in its burden to demonstrate Apple
is an illegal monopolist.”
